Helpful preparation checklist

Use this simple checklist before your moving day:

  • Pack non-essential items early
  • Label boxes clearly by room and priority
  • Disassemble furniture where practical
  • Empty drawers, shelves, and cupboards where required
  • Separate fragile items and keep them well cushioned
  • Measure large items against doorways and stair access
  • Reserve building access or loading space if needed
  • Keep essentials such as documents, keys, chargers, and medication with you

If you live in a tenement or apartment block in Newington, consider how items will be carried through shared spaces. Protecting the route inside your property can help prevent scuffs and keep relations with neighbours smooth. Pricing factors for a moving van in Newington

Customers often want to understand what affects the cost of a moving van service before they enquire. While exact prices vary from job to job, several common factors influence the quote. Knowing these details can help you compare services fairly and avoid surprises later.

Typical pricing factors include:

  • Volume of items – More belongings usually require a larger van or more loading time.
  • Distance – Local moves across Newington may differ from longer journeys outside the area.
  • Access conditions – Stairs, long carries, restricted parking, and narrow streets can affect time and manpower.
  • Loading and unloading support – A van-only job is different from a service that includes lifting help.
  • Furniture complexity – Heavy wardrobes, pianos, appliances, or delicate pieces may require extra handling.
  • Scheduling requirements – Peak moving dates or time-sensitive moves may need more careful planning.

A detailed conversation before booking is the best way to get an accurate quote. When you provide honest information about what needs moving, where from, and where to, the service can be tailored to suit your actual needs. How to choose the right van size and support level

One of the most common questions customers ask is how to choose the correct van for their move. The answer depends on the size of your load, the layout of the property, and whether you need help lifting and carrying. A van that is too small may require extra trips; one that is too large may be harder to position on busy streets or narrow access roads.

Helpful questions to consider include:

  • How many rooms are being moved?
  • Do you have large furniture or appliances?
  • Will items need to be carried up or down stairs?
  • Is parking available close to the property?
  • Are there any time restrictions on access or loading?
  • Do you want loading, unloading, or full support?

If you are not sure, it is better to describe your belongings in detail rather than guessing. A moving van in Newington can often be matched to the job once the team understands the amount of furniture, the type of access, and the route involved. Being accurate from the start helps you avoid underestimating the move.
